United States Twenty-dollar Gold Piece, 1905–7, gold coin 1911, Gold, Diam. 1 5/16 in. ( cm), Augustus Saint-Gaudens (American, Dublin 1848–1907 Cornish, New Hampshire), Having proclaimed the coinage produced by the United States Mint uninspired and commonplace, President Theodore Roosevelt invited Saint-Gaudens to redesign the ten- and twenty-dollar gold coins and the one-cent piece
